Agios Ioannis
Agios Ioannis is an island in Samos, North Aegean Islands. Agios Ioannis is situated nearby to the village Palaiochori, as well as near the locality Mourterí.- Type: Island
- Description: islet off West Samos, Greece
- Also known as: “Kátergo”, “Nisida Katergon”, and “Nísos Kátergon”
